Strategy refers to basic directional decisions, that is, to purpose and mission

2

Strategy consists of the important actions necessary to realize these directions

3

Strategy answers the question: What should the organization be doing?

4

In sum, what are the ends we seek and how should we achieve them?

A strategic plan should be developed whenever an organization undertakes a major new initiative (such as patient safety). The plan adds the perspective of the long view to short term externally driven initiatives such as compliance with the National Patient Safety Goals.
